These were never given much use up until episode 14 of The Mandalorian, in which Boba trashes a large group of stormtroopers with a variety of weapons and gadgets. In fact, most people didn’t even know the kneepad rocket dark launchers were there. They seem to pack one hell of a punch though.
They first appeared in The Empire Strikes Back, and original Boba Fett actor Jeremy Bulloch even described them as “little knee pads, where I could fire darts with.” However, they weren’t properly identified until much later, thanks to Star Wars’ extensive visual dictionaries.Of course, we can’t end this article without talking about Jango and Boba’s iconic set of armor, which has seen many changes over the years.
Following Boba’s appearance in The Mandalorian, it’s been re-canonized that Jango received the durasteel-beskar armor from the band of Mandalorians who raised him. He then made a number of modifications to improve its combat effectiveness, something that Boba pushed even further. The large dent on Boba’s helmet, unless stated otherwise, comes from a duel with fellow bounty hunter Cad Bane – a cancelled Clone Wars episode would’ve shown this confrontation and ended with the death of the latter gunslinger, who’s alive and kicking in the post-Clone Wars animated seriesWatch The Book of Boba Fett now on Disney+
